 | /* | 
 |  * Implementing ->set_parent() here isn't really required because the parent | 
 |  * will be explicitly selected in the driver code via the DP_CLK_SEL mux in | 
 |  * the SOR_CLK_CNTRL register. This is primarily for compatibility with the | 
 |  * Tegra186 and later SoC generations where the BPMP implements this clock | 
 |  * and doesn't expose the mux via the common clock framework. | 
 |  */ | 
 |  | 
 | static int tegra_clk_sor_pad_set_parent(struct clk_hw *hw, u8 index) | 
 | { | 
 | 	struct tegra_clk_sor_pad *pad = to_pad(hw); | 
 | 	struct tegra_sor *sor = pad->sor; |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, SOR_CLK_CNTRL); | 
 | 	value &= ~S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_MASK; | 
 |  | 
 | 	switch (index) { | 
 | 	case 0: | 
 | 		value |= S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_SINGLE_PCLK; | 
 | 		break; | 
 |  | 
 | 	case 1: | 
 | 		value |= S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_SINGLE_DPCLK; | 
 | 		break;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, SOR_CLK_CNTRL); | 
 |  | 
 | 	return 0;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static u8 tegra_clk_sor_pad_get_parent(struct clk_hw *hw) | 
 | { | 
 | 	struct tegra_clk_sor_pad *pad = to_pad(hw); | 
 | 	struct tegra_sor *sor = pad->sor; | 
 | 	u8 parent = U8_MAX; |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, SOR_CLK_CNTRL); | 
 |  | 
 | 	switch (value & S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_MASK) { | 
 | 	case S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_SINGLE_PCLK: | 
 | 	case S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_DIFF_PCLK: | 
 | 		parent = 0; | 
 | 		break; | 
 |  | 
 | 	case S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_SINGLE_DPCLK: | 
 | 	case SOR_CLK_CNTRL_DP_CLK_SEL_DIFF_DPCLK: | 
 | 		parent = 1; | 
 | 		break;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	return parent;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static const struct clk_ops tegra_clk_sor_pad_ops = { | 
 | 	.set_parent = tegra_clk_sor_pad_set_parent, | 
 | 	.get_parent = tegra_clk_sor_pad_get_parent, | 
 | }; | 
 |  | 
 | static struct clk *tegra_clk_sor_pad_register(struct tegra_sor *sor, | 
 | 					      const char *name) | 
 | { | 
 | 	struct tegra_clk_sor_pad *pad; | 
 | 	struct clk_init_data init; | 
 | 	struct clk *clk; | 
 |  | 
 | 	pad = devm_kzalloc(sor->dev, sizeof(*pad), GFP_KERNEL); | 
 | 	if (!pad) | 
 | 		return ERR_PTR(-ENOMEM); | 
 |  | 
 | 	pad->sor = sor; | 
 |  | 
 | 	init.name = name; | 
 | 	init.flags = 0; | 
 | 	init.parent_names = tegra_clk_sor_pad_parents[sor->index]; | 
 | 	init.num_parents = ARRAY_SIZE(tegra_clk_sor_pad_parents[sor->index]); | 
 | 	init.ops = &tegra_clk_sor_pad_ops; | 
 |  | 
 | 	pad->hw.init = &init; | 
 |  | 
 | 	clk = devm_clk_register(sor->dev, &pad->hw); | 
 |  | 
 | 	return clk; | 
 | } |

 | static int tegra_sor_power_up_lanes(struct tegra_sor *sor, unsigned int lanes) | 
 | { | 
 | 	unsigned long timeout; |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* | 
 | 	 * Clear or set the PD_TXD bit corresponding to each lane, depending | 
 | 	 * on whether it is used or not. | 
 | 	 */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(lanes <= 2) | 
 | 		value &= ~(S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[3]) | | 
 | 			   S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[2])); | 
 | 	else | 
 | 		value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[3]) | | 
 | 			 S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[2]);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(lanes <= 1) | 
 | 		value &= ~S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[1]); | 
 | 	else | 
 | 		value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[1]);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(lanes == 0) | 
 | 		value &= ~S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[0]); | 
 | 	else | 
 | 		value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[0]); | 
 |  |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* start lane sequencer */ | 
 | 	value = S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_TRIGGER | S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_SEQUENCE_DOWN | | 
 | 		S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_POWER_STATE_UP;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L); | 
 |  | 
 | 	timeout = jiffies + msecs_to_jiffies(250); | 
 |  | 
 | 	while (time_before(jiffies, timeout)) { | 
 | 		value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L); | 
 | 		if ((value & S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_TRIGGER) == 0) | 
 | 			break; | 
 |  | 
 | 		usleep_range(250, 1000); |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	if ((value & S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_TRIGGER) != 0) | 
 | 		return -ETIMEDOUT; | 
 |  | 
 | 	return 0;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static int tegra_sor_power_down_lanes(struct tegra_sor *sor) | 
 | { | 
 | 	unsigned long timeout; |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* power down all lanes */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 | 	value &= ~(S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D_3 | S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D_0 | | 
 | 		   S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D_1 | SOR_DP_PADCTL_PD_TXD_2); |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* start lane sequencer */ | 
 | 	value = S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_TRIGGER | S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_SEQUENCE_UP | | 
 | 		S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_POWER_STATE_DOWN;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L); | 
 |  | 
 | 	timeout = jiffies + msecs_to_jiffies(250); | 
 |  | 
 | 	while (time_before(jiffies, timeout)) { | 
 | 		value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L); | 
 | 		if ((value & S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_TRIGGER) == 0) | 
 | 			break; | 
 |  | 
 | 		usleep_range(25, 100); |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	if ((value & SOR_LANE_SEQ_CTL_TRIGGER) != 0) | 
 | 		return -ETIMEDOUT; | 
 |  | 
 | 	return 0;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static void tegra_sor_dp_precharge(struct tegra_sor *sor, unsigned int lanes) | 
 | { |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* pre-charge all used lanes */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(lanes <= 2) | 
 | 		value &= ~(S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[3]) | | 
 | 			   S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[2])); | 
 | 	else | 
 | 		value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[3]) | | 
 | 			 S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[2]);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(lanes <= 1) | 
 | 		value &= ~S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[1]); | 
 | 	else | 
 | 		value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[1]);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(lanes == 0) | 
 | 		value &= ~S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[0]); | 
 | 	else | 
 | 		value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D(sor->soc->lane_map[0]); | 
 |  |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 |  | 
 | 	usleep_range(15, 100); | 
 |  |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 | 	value &= ~(S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D_3 | S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D_2 | | 
 | 		   S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D_1 | SOR_DP_PADCTL_CM_TXD_0); |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static void tegra_sor_dp_term_calibrate(struct tegra_sor *sor) | 
 | { | 
 | 	u32 mask = 0x08, adj = 0, value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* enable pad calibration logic */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 | 	value &= ~SOR_DP_PADCTL_PAD_CAL_PD;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 |  |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 | 	value |= SOR_PLL1_TMDS_TERM;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 |  | 
 | 	while (mask) { | 
 | 		adj |= mask; | 
 |  | 
 | 		value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 | 		value &= ~SOR_PLL1_TMDS_TERMADJ_MASK; | 
 | 		value |= SOR_PLL1_TMDS_TERMADJ(adj); | 
 | 		t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 |  | 
 | 		usleep_range(100, 200); | 
 |  | 
 | 		value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 | 		if (value & SOR_PLL1_TERM_COMPOUT) | 
 | 			adj &= ~mask; | 
 |  | 
 | 		mask >>= 1;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 | 	value &= ~SOR_PLL1_TMDS_TERMADJ_MASK; | 
 | 	value |= SOR_PLL1_TMDS_TERMADJ(adj); |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->pll1); |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* disable pad calibration logic */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 | 	value |= SOR_DP_PADCTL_PAD_CAL_PD;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, sor->soc->regs->dp_padctl0); | 
 | } |

 | struct tegra_sor_params { | 
 | 	/* number of link clocks per line */ | 
 | 	unsigned int num_clocks; | 
 | 	/* ratio between input and output */ | 
 | 	u64 ratio; | 
 | 	/* precision factor */ | 
 | 	u64 precision; | 
 |  | 
 | 	unsigned int active_polarity; | 
 | 	unsigned int active_count; | 
 | 	unsigned int active_frac; | 
 | 	unsigned int tu_size; | 
 | 	unsigned int error; | 
 | }; | 
 |  | 
 | static int tegra_sor_compute_params(struct tegra_sor *sor, | 
 | 				    struct tegra_sor_params *params, | 
 | 				    unsigned int tu_size) | 
 | { | 
 | 	u64 active_sym, active_count, frac, approx; | 
 | 	u32 active_polarity, active_frac = 0; | 
 | 	const u64 f = params->precision; | 
 | 	s64 error; | 
 |  | 
 | 	active_sym = params->ratio * tu_size; | 
 | 	active_count = div_u64(active_sym, f) * f; | 
 | 	frac = active_sym - active_count;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* fraction < 0.5 */ | 
 | 	if (frac >= (f / 2)) { | 
 | 		active_polarity = 1; | 
 | 		frac = f - frac; | 
 | 	} else { | 
 | 		active_polarity = 0;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(frac != 0) { | 
 | 		frac = div_u64(f * f,  frac); /* 1/fraction */ | 
 | 		if (frac <= (15 * f)) { | 
 | 			active_frac = div_u64(frac, f); | 
 |  | 
 | 			/* round up */ | 
 | 			if (active_polarity) | 
 | 				active_frac++; | 
 | 		} else { | 
 | 			active_frac = active_polarity ? 1 : 15; | 
 | 		} |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(active_frac == 1) | 
 | 		active_polarity = 0; |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(active_polarity == 1) { | 
 | 		if (active_frac) { | 
 | 			approx = active_count + (active_frac * (f - 1)) * f; | 
 | 			approx = div_u64(approx, active_frac * f); | 
 | 		} else { | 
 | 			approx = active_count + f; | 
 | 		} | 
 | 	} else { | 
 | 		if (active_frac) | 
 | 			approx = active_count + div_u64(f, active_frac); | 
 | 		else | 
 | 			approx = active_count;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	error = div_s64(active_sym - approx, tu_size); | 
 | 	error *= params->num_clocks; |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(error <= 0 && abs(error) < params->error) { | 
 | 		params->active_count = div_u64(active_count, f); | 
 | 		params->active_polarity = active_polarity; | 
 | 		params->active_frac = active_frac; | 
 | 		params->error = abs(error); | 
 | 		params->tu_size = tu_size; | 
 |  | 
 | 		if (error == 0) | 
 | 			return true;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	return false;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static int tegra_sor_compute_config(struct tegra_sor *sor, | 
 | 				    const struct drm_display_mode *mode, | 
 | 				    struct tegra_sor_config *config, | 
 | 				    struct drm_dp_link *link) | 
 | { | 
 | 	const u64 f = 100000, link_rate = link->rate * 1000; | 
 | 	const u64 pclk = (u64)mode->clock * 1000; | 
 | 	u64 input, output, watermark, num; | 
 | 	struct tegra_sor_params params; | 
 | 	u32 num_syms_per_line; | 
 | 	unsigned int i; |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(!link_rate || !link->lanes || !pclk || !config->bits_per_pixel) | 
 | 		return -EINVAL; | 
 |  | 
 | 	input = pclk * config->bits_per_pixel; | 
 | 	output = link_rate * 8 * link->lanes; |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(input >= output) | 
 | 		return -ERANGE; | 
 |  | 
 | 	memset(¶ms, 0, sizeof(params)); | 
 | 	params.ratio = div64_u64(input * f, output); | 
 | 	params.num_clocks = div_u64(link_rate * mode->hdisplay, pclk); | 
 | 	params.precision = f; | 
 | 	params.error = 64 * f; | 
 | 	params.tu_size = 64; | 
 |  | 
 | 	for (i = params.tu_size; i >= 32; i--) | 
 | 		if (tegra_sor_compute_params(sor, ¶ms, i)) | 
 | 			break; |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(params.active_frac == 0) { | 
 | 		config->active_polarity = 0; | 
 | 		config->active_count = params.active_count; | 
 |  | 
 | 		if (!params.active_polarity) | 
 | 			config->active_count--; | 
 |  | 
 | 		config->tu_size = params.tu_size; | 
 | 		config->active_frac = 1; | 
 | 	} else { | 
 | 		config->active_polarity = params.active_polarity; | 
 | 		config->active_count = params.active_count; | 
 | 		config->active_frac = params.active_frac; | 
 | 		config->tu_size = params.tu_size;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	dev_dbg(sor->dev, | 
 | 		"polarity: %d active count: %d tu size: %d active frac: %d\n", | 
 | 		config->active_polarity, config->active_count, | 
 | 		config->tu_size, config->active_frac); | 
 |  | 
 | 	watermark = params.ratio * config->tu_size * (f - params.ratio); | 
 | 	watermark = div_u64(watermark, f); | 
 |  | 
 | 	watermark = div_u64(watermark + params.error, f); | 
 | 	config->watermark = watermark + (config->bits_per_pixel / 8) + 2; | 
 | 	num_syms_per_line = (mode->hdisplay * config->bits_per_pixel) * | 
 | 			    (link->lanes * 8);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(config->watermark > 30) { | 
 | 		config->watermark = 30; | 
 | 		dev_err(sor->dev, | 
 | 			"unable to compute TU size, forcing watermark to %u\n", | 
 | 			config->watermark); | 
 | 	} else if (config->watermark > num_syms_per_line) { | 
 | 		config->watermark = num_syms_per_line; | 
 | 		dev_err(sor->dev, "watermark too high, forcing to %u\n", | 
 | 			config->watermark); |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* compute the number of symbols per horizontal blanking interval */ | 
 | 	num = ((mode->htotal - mode->hdisplay) - 7) * link_rate; | 
 | 	config->hblank_symbols = div_u64(num, pclk); | 
 |  | 
 | 	if (link->caps.enhanced_framing) | 
 | 		config->hblank_symbols -= 3; | 
 |  | 
 | 	config->hblank_symbols -= 12 / link->lanes;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* compute the number of symbols per vertical blanking interval */ | 
 | 	num = (mode->hdisplay - 25) * link_rate; | 
 | 	config->vblank_symbols = div_u64(num, pclk); | 
 | 	config->vblank_symbols -= 36 / link->lanes + 4; | 
 |  | 
 | 	dev_dbg(sor->dev, "blank symbols: H:%u V:%u\n", config->hblank_symbols, | 
 | 		config->vblank_symbols); | 
 |  | 
 | 	return 0; | 
 | } |

 | static inline u32 tegra_sor_hdmi_subpack(const u8 *ptr, size_t size) | 
 | { | 
 | 	u32 value = 0; | 
 | 	size_t i; | 
 |  | 
 | 	for (i = size; i > 0; i--) | 
 | 		value = (value << 8) | ptr[i - 1]; | 
 |  | 
 | 	return value;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static void tegra_sor_hdmi_write_infopack(struct tegra_sor *sor, | 
 | 					  const void *data, size_t size) | 
 | { | 
 | 	const u8 *ptr = data; | 
 | 	unsigned long offset; | 
 | 	size_t i, j; |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 |  | 
 | 	switch (ptr[0]) { | 
 | 	case HDMI_INFOFRAME_TYPE_AVI: | 
 | 		offset = SOR_HDMI_AVI_INFOFRAME_HEADER; | 
 | 		break; | 
 |  | 
 | 	case HDMI_INFOFRAME_TYPE_AUDIO: | 
 | 		offset = SOR_HDMI_AUDIO_INFOFRAME_HEADER; | 
 | 		break; | 
 |  | 
 | 	case HDMI_INFOFRAME_TYPE_VENDOR: | 
 | 		offset = SOR_HDMI_VSI_INFOFRAME_HEADER; | 
 | 		break; | 
 |  | 
 | 	default: | 
 | 		dev_err(sor->dev, "unsupported infoframe type: %02x\n", | 
 | 			ptr[0]); | 
 | 		return;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	value = INFOFRAME_HEADER_TYPE(ptr[0]) | | 
 | 		INFOFRAME_HEADER_VERSION(ptr[1]) | | 
 | 		INFOFRAME_HEADER_LEN(ptr[2]); |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, offset); | 
 | 	offset++;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* | 
 | 	 * Each subpack contains 7 bytes, divided into: | 
 | 	 * - subpack_low: bytes 0 - 3 | 
 | 	 * - subpack_high: bytes 4 - 6 (with byte 7 padded to 0x00) | 
 | 	 */ | 
 | 	for (i = 3, j = 0; i < size; i += 7, j += 8) { | 
 | 		size_t rem = size - i, num = min_t(size_t, rem, 4); | 
 |  | 
 | 		value = tegra_sor_hdmi_subpack(&ptr[i], num); | 
 | 		t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, offset++); | 
 |  | 
 | 		num = min_t(size_t, rem - num, 3); | 
 |  | 
 | 		value = tegra_sor_hdmi_subpack(&ptr[i + 4], num); | 
 | 		t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, offset++); | 
 | 	} |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static int | 
 | tegra_sor_hdmi_setup_avi_infoframe(struct tegra_sor *sor, | 
 | 				   const struct drm_display_mode *mode) | 
 | { | 
 | 	u8 buffer[HDMI_INFOFRAME_SIZE(AVI)]; | 
 | 	struct hdmi_avi_infoframe frame; | 
 | 	u32 value; | 
 | 	int err; |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* disable AVI infoframe */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, SOR_HDMI_AVI_INFOFRAME_CTRL); | 
 | 	value &= ~INFOFRAME_CTRL_SINGLE; | 
 | 	value &= ~INFOFRAME_CTRL_OTHER; | 
 | 	value &= ~INFOFRAME_CTRL_ENABLE;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, SOR_HDMI_AVI_INFOFRAME_CTRL); | 
 |  | 
 | 	err = drm_hdmi_avi_infoframe_from_display_mode(&frame, | 
 | 						       &sor->output.connector, mode); | 
 | 	if (err < 0) { | 
 | 		dev_err(sor->dev, "failed to setup AVI infoframe: %d\n", err); | 
 | 		return err;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	err = hdmi_avi_infoframe_pack(&frame, buffer, sizeof(buffer)); | 
 | 	if (err < 0) { | 
 | 		dev_err(sor->dev, "failed to pack AVI infoframe: %d\n", err); | 
 | 		return err; | 
 | 	} | 
 |  | 
 | 	tegra_sor_hdmi_write_infopack(sor, buffer, err); |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* enable AVI infoframe */ | 
 | 	value = tegra_sor_readl(sor, SOR_HDMI_AVI_INFOFRAME_CTRL); | 
 | 	value |= INFOFRAME_CTRL_CHECKSUM_ENABLE; | 
 | 	value |= INFOFRAME_CTRL_ENABLE; | 
 | 	tegra_sor_writel(sor, value, SOR_HDMI_AVI_INFOFRAME_CTRL); | 
 |  | 
 | 	return 0;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| static void tegra_sor_write_eld(struct tegra_sor *sor) | 
 | { | 
 | 	size_t length = drm_eld_size(sor->output.connector.eld), i; | 
 |  | 
 | 	for (i = 0; i < length; i++) | 
 | 		tegra_sor_writel(sor, i << 8 | sor->output.connector.eld[i], | 
 | 				 SOR_AUDIO_HDA_ELD_BUFWR); |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* | 
 | 	 * The HDA codec will always report an ELD buffer size of 96 bytes and | 
 | 	 * the HDA codec driver will check that each byte read from the buffer | 
 | 	 * is valid. Therefore every byte must be written, even if no 96 bytes | 
 | 	 * were parsed from EDID. | 
 | 	 */ | 
 | 	for (i = length; i < 96; i++) | 
 | 		tegra_sor_writel(sor, i << 8 | 0, SOR_AUDIO_HDA_ELD_BUFWR); | 
 | } |
